After the Congress declined the invitation to the Ram Temple inauguration in Ayodhya, the BJP came down heavily on the party, terming it a “well-thought-out” strategy of the INDIA alliance to “disrespect” the faith of Indians. The party said that Congress leaders have ‘lost their mind’ just as Ravana did in the “Treta Yug”.
BJP national spokesperson Nalin Kohli told PTI that it is official that the grand old party and its senior leaders will not be present for the January 22 ceremony in Ayodhya. He expressed little surprise, noting that over the last few decades, the Congress had taken no steps to ensure the construction of a Ram temple in Ayodhya.

Another BJP MP Manoj Tiwari expressed astonishment at the Ram temple trust extending invitations to “those who never wanted the construction of the Ram temple in Ayodhya and even filed an affidavit in court calling Lord Ram an imaginary figure”.
Tiwari, in a veiled reference to the Congress leaders, commented that despite being invited, they seem to have “lost their mind,” drawing a parallel with Ravana’s behaviour in the ‘Treta Yug’ stating, “The ‘Treta Yug’ will start soon after the ‘Kal Yug’, according to scriptures. I feel that it (Treta Yug) has already begun in the time of (Prime Minister) Narendra Modi. It is the start of Ram Rajya,” he told PTI.

Former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an also took a jab at Congress for turning down the invitation, referring to it as a rejection or disowning of the country’s identity.
“Ram is our Lord. He represents the soul and the identity of Bharat. The turning down of the invitation to the Pran Pratishtha by the Congress is a rejection of India’s identity and culture. It is because of such positions that the Congress takes that it has been reduced to the margins today,” the former Madhya Pradesh CM said.
BJP spokesperson Jaiveer Shergill condemned the action, questioning it as a “well-thought-out” strategy of the INDIA bloc to “disrespect” the faith of Indians.
Shergill, who was associated with Congress before, posted on X, “DMK gave a call to finish the Sanatan Dharma Congress, rejecting the invitation to attend the inauguration of the Ram Mandir. Coincidence? or a well-thought-out strategy of INDI to disrespect the faith of Indians?”
“May Lord Ram forgive & eradicate INDI’s & Cong’s politics of hatred!” he added.
‘Congress declines inauguration invitation’
On Wednesday, the Congress party’s senior leaders, including Mallikarjun Kharge, Sonia Gandhi, and Adhir Ranjan Chowdhury, turned down an invitation to the ‘Pran Pratistha’ ceremony of Lord Ram Lalla, set for January 22 in Ayodhya. Jairam Ramesh, the party’s general secretary, conveyed this decision through a statement, claiming it to be a “BJP and RSS event”.
The statement highlighted that last month, the Congress President, Mallikarjun Kharge, Sonia Gandhi, and Adhir Ranjan Chowdhury received an invitation to attend the inauguration ceremony of the Ram Mandir at Ayodhya. However, the leaders respectfully declined the invitation.
“Lord Ram is worshipped by millions in our country. Religion is a personal matter. But the RSS/BJP have long made a political project of the temple in Ayodhya. The inauguration of the incomplete temple by the leaders of the BJP and the RSS has been obviously brought forward for electoral gain. While abiding by the 2019 Supreme Court judgment and honouring the sentiments of millions who revere Lord Ram, Shri Mallikarjun Kharge, Smt. Sonia Gandhi and Shri Adhir Ranjan Chowdhury have respectfully declined the invitation to what is clearly an RSS/BJP event,” the statement read.
